To change the display information while receiving an FM RDS station
Press DISP. Each time you press the button, the display changes as follows:
Station name
Frequency
PTY (Programme type)
Clock time
Selecting FM reception sound
When an FM stereo broadcast is hard to receive:
Press MO/RND (Mono/Random) while listening to an FM stereo broadcast. The MO (Mono) indicator lights up on the display and the sound you hear becomes monaural but reception will be improved.
MO/RND
Lights up when receiving an FM broadcast in stereo.
To restore the stereo effect, press the same button again.
